    Biffa treatment facility - Horsham
    Biffa operates a significant waste management site in Warnham (Horsham) known as Brookhurst Wood. It's a large facility for West Sussex County Council, featuring a Mechanical Biological Treatment (MBT) plant and a landfill site, processing non-recyclable waste, generating refuse-derived fuel (RDF) and electricity, and handling road sweepings and soil. The site is central to the region's waste strategy, reducing landfill reliance by treating waste to recover resources and energy.
